    What is an IP Address and How Does It Work?

    An IP address is a unique identifier assigned to devices connected to the internet. It allows computers to communicate, ensuring data reaches the correct destination. The IPv4 protocol is the most common standard in the USA and globally. Each IP address consists of four octets separated by periods, with values ranging from 0 to 255. Routing mechanisms use these addresses to direct traffic efficiently.

    Understanding the Structure of 185.63.2253.200

    When analyzing 185.63.2253.200, the problem is immediately clear. The first octet, 185, and the second octet, 63, are within valid IPv4 ranges. However, the third octet, 2253, far exceeds the maximum 255. This irregularity makes it technically impossible under current networking protocols. The fourth octet, 200, is valid, but the overall address remains invalid.
